Williams' head of aero leaves the team

Williams' lead aerodynamicist Dirk De Beer has left the team, following a torrid start to the 2018 season. Just over a month since the departure of chief designer Ed Wood from the team, Williams have confirmed that their Head of Aerodynamics, Dirk De Beer, has also left. From South Africa, De Beer joined Williams from Ferrari, where he had worked in the same role between 2013 & 2017. Prior to Ferrari, he was with Renault between 2008 & 2013, having joined Enstone from BMW Sauber, where he had worked since 2003.
